What it means to be a professional cartoonist today is not what it meant 50, or even 10 years ago.
Our industry changed more rapidly these past years than at any time in the 75-year history of the National Cartoonists Society. Gone are the days when you needed to land a big newspaper syndication deal to validate your standing as a professional artist. New media and modern creative industries expand the opportunities and outlets for today’s cartoonists and reimagine what it looks like to work professionally.
As the premier organization of professional cartoonists, we are compelled to evolve too. To encourage exciting young artists, to celebrate new voices and styles, and to continue to support our talented members working throughout this diverse industry.
We welcome you all to apply and be part of the generous NCS community.
We believe in actions over words. To that end, the board of directors of the National Cartoonists Society has spent the past two years meticulously re-writing our outdated by-laws, line-by-line, to bring them in line with the shape of our industry in 2022 and beyond.
This updated ethos does not diminish the prestige of being part of the world’s premier cartooning organization. We believe it ensures that our distinguished legacy extends well beyond the bounds of our traditional 20th Century beginnings.
After sharing them with our members, we have now ratified and adopted our updated by-laws. The National Cartoonists Society welcomes all professional cartoonists to become part of our ever-creative, evolving community.

NCS membership is open to all creative professionals who earn a substantial part of their income working in the fields of cartooning, illustration, animation and graphic storytelling. We are an organization of esteemed peers and we welcome new members!
